About iShares MSCI China ETF

MCHI is an ETF that seeks to track the investment results of the MSCI China Index. It provides broad exposure to the Chinese equity market, primarily focusing on large and mid-cap companies listed in Hong Kong and Shanghai. MCHI serves as a core holding for investors looking to gain diversified exposure to the performance and growth potential of the companies within the People's Republic of China.

About Raymond James Financial, Inc.

Raymond James Financial is a financial holding company whose major operations include wealth management, investment banking, asset management, and commercial banking. The company has more than 14,000 employees and supports more than 5,000 independent contractor financial advisors across the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om. Approximately 90% of the company's revenue is from the U.S. and 70% is from the company's wealth-management segment.
